In this work we address the problem of manufacturing machine parts from sensed data. Constructing geometric models for objects from sensed data is the intermediate step in a reverse engineering manufacturing system. Sensors are usually inaccurate, providing uncertain sensed information. We construct geometric entities with uncertainty models from noisy measurements for the objects under consideration, and proceed to do reasoning on the uncertain geometries, thus, adding robustness to the construction of geometries from sensed data.  相似文献

The PREMO standard, Presentation Environment for Multimedia Objects, is a major new standard under development within ISO/IEC. It addresses the creation of, presentation of, and interaction with all forms of information using single or multiple media. In this paper we give a formal LOTOS specification, amenable to automatic verification, of the PREMO synchronisable object, which is one of the central parts of the standard. Various design options are investigated by a combination of constraint oriented specification and model checking. This shows the usefulness of formal specification and automatic verification during the design phase of an international standard. Received April 1997 / Accepted in revised form July 1998  相似文献

In multiparty collaborative data mining, participants contribute their own data sets and hope to collaboratively mine a comprehensive model based on the pooled data set. How to efficiently mine a quality model without breaching each party's privacy is the major challenge. In this paper, we propose an approach based on geometric data perturbation and data mining service-oriented framework. The key problem of applying geometric data perturbation in multiparty collaborative mining is to securely unify multiple geometric perturbations that are preferred by different parties, respectively. We have developed three protocols for perturbation unification. Our approach has three unique features compared to the existing approaches: 1) with geometric data perturbation, these protocols can work for many existing popular data mining algorithms, while most of other approaches are only designed for a particular mining algorithm; 2) both the two major factors: data utility and privacy guarantee are well preserved, compared to other perturbation-based approaches; and 3) two of the three proposed protocols also have great scalability in terms of the number of participants, while many existing cryptographic approaches consider only two or a few more participants. We also study different features of the three protocols and show the advantages of different protocols in experiments.  相似文献

Gear Geometric Design by B-Spline Curve Fitting and Sweep Surface Modelling   总被引:2,自引:0,他引:2  
In this paper, B-spline curve fitting and sweep surface generation are used for the geometric design of involute gears. Tooth profiles are described by a B-spline formulation based on interpolating data points with first and second derivative constrains. Tooth surfaces are generated by sweeping the B-spline profiles along specified trajectories. This representation scheme enables tooth shapes to be inter-actively controlled by manipulating control polygons and sweep trajectories. A CAD–CAE integration allows the analysis of contact and structural three-dimensional problems for various geometric configurations. In the paper, the methodology is applied to the geometric design of involute pinions of face gear drives.  相似文献

XML及STEP标准在流程工业信息集成中的应用研究   总被引:1,自引:0,他引:1  
李荷华  刘杰 《计算机应用》2004,24(6):145-147
流程工业中数据结构复杂,数据之间关系多种多样,如何对这些数据实现标准化处理是一件很困难的事。以前人们采用的方法多为各种零散的方法,或者是借助于制造行业发展起来的STEP来实现,但是STEP主要是用在表述结构化数据的,而对于非结构化数据以及半结构化数据的描述存在很大困难。因此,文中提出用XML来表述流程工业的非结构化数据和半结构化数据,采用XML与STEP标准结合的方式,实现对流程工业数据的集中处理,以便让那些建立在其上的其他信息处理过程中应用。文末给出了XML与STEP相结合所描述的一个典型过程工业信息集成应用案例。  相似文献

动态数据交换技术及其实现方法研究   总被引:5,自引:0,他引:5  
随着软件系统开放性的日益增强,数据交换技术已成为越来越重要的一个研究课题。文章介绍了系统实现中采用的数据交换技术,着重研究了基于消息传递的动态数据交换技术(DDE)的实现机理和利用其建立数据交换应用的方法。在实际系统的数据交换中应用DDE技术,在实践中获得了良好的效果。文中还研究了DDE技术的扩展,即对象链接与嵌入(OLE)的原理和实现。  相似文献
